I’ve consulted another lawyer who said that if the portal isn’t open for uploading of documents, then we should have the documents sent to AIMA via registered mail, just to be sure we comply with what they requested in the email. But he doesn’t actually believe that this step of refreshing documents will necessarily move things along quicker…

Last week, my attorney sent a certified copy of all our updated and Apostilled documents to AIMA’s office in Lisbon. She also included a letter inquiring about the change in our status—from ā€œawaiting submissionā€ to ā€œawaiting analysis.ā€

While I don’t expect this to speed things up, the main goal is to ensure AIMA knows we’ve met all our obligations and to help prevent our application from being purged from the system. Hopefully, we haven’t lost our place in line (or won’t have to re-Apostille everything), but time will tell.
